Pablo Carreno-Busta and Andrey Rublev will fight against each other in the semifinal of German Tennis Championships for the 3rd time of their career. They are scheduled to play on Saturday at 3:00 pm on CENTER COURT.
Pablo Carreno-Busta: results and record
Ranked no. 59, Carreno-Busta reached the semifinal after defeating Yannick Hanfmann 7-65 6-4, Jan-Lennard Struff 6-1 7-64 and Fabio Fognini 3-6 6-2 7-64.
Carreno-Busta’s best result of the current season was getting to the semi-finals in Antalya.
Pablo has a 13-11 win-loss record in 2019, 7-7 on clay (See FULL STATS).
Last year in Hamburg
Pablo lost in the quarter 7-63 6-4 to Nikoloz Basilashvili.
Andrey Rublev: results and record
Ranked no. 78, Andrey got to the semifinal after beating Christian Garin 6-4 7-65, Casper Ruud 3-6 7-5 6-3 and Dominic Thiem 7-63 7-65.
The Russian best result of the current year was getting to the final in the Indian Wells Challenger.
Andrey has a 26-16 win-loss record in 2019, 7-4 on clay (See FULL STATS).
Last year in Hamburg
Rublev didn’t play in Hamburg in 2018.

Prediction and head to head Pablo Carreno-Busta vs. Andrey Rublev
This will be the 3rd time that Pablo Carreno-Busta and Andrey Rublev play each other. The head to head is 2-0 for Rublev (see full H2H stats), 1-0 on clay.
The last time that they played, Rublev won 6-4 6-76 6-3 in the qualifications in Rome back in 2015.
